On-page signals that connect your business to the Canberra area
Building local relevance starts with how your pages communicate who you help and where you help them. Service pages should explain the problem you solve and reference the areas you serve in a natural, helpful way. Adding seo agency Canberra location-aware content such as suburb-level coverage, service process details, and customer-focused explanations makes the page more useful. It also helps search engines understand that your business is relevant to local queries.
Technical on-page elements contribute too. Your title tags, meta descriptions, headers, and internal links should support the same local theme across the site. Consistent NAP information (name, address, phone) reinforces identity and reduces ambiguity for both users and search engines. When these on-page components work together, your website becomes easier to crawl, easier to trust, and more likely to earn visibility for local searches.
Google Business profile and reputation as conversion drivers
A well-optimized business profile can be the difference between “seeing your listing” and “choosing your business.” The most effective profiles include complete categories, accurate service areas, and clear business hours that match what customers experience in real life. Adding high-quality photos of your team, workspace, and completed work builds confidence for people who have never used your services. Each update is an opportunity to reinforce relevance and improve click-through rates from local results.
Reputation signals influence local decisions, often as much as rankings. Encouraging customers to leave detailed reviews helps you capture more long-tail search intent and provides social proof for prospects. Responding to reviews, addressing questions, and keeping messaging consistent across platforms supports credibility.
